The Mössbauer effect and chemistry. Part I. Spectra of octahedral cis–trans-isomers and related compounds

The Mössbauer spectra of a series of low-spin octahedral cis–trans-isomers of iron(II) have been measured, and the results rationalised using the general expression for electric field gradients. Part of the series is made up of some new ethyl isocyanide complexes, and the study includes derivatives of formula [Fe(CN)(CNR)5]+. The cis–trans isomerism reported for dicyanobis-(1,10-phenanthroline)iron(II) is discussed.
